What Are copyright Futures? Futures Trading Described
At its core, a futures agreement is merely an agreement in between two parties to acquire or sell a certain asset (like Bitcoin or Ethereum) at a predetermined price on a specific future day.
In the context of newbies copyright trading, it's important to understand both major types you'll encounter on exchanges:
1. Standard Futures (Dated/Expiring Futures).
These contracts have actually a repaired expiration date (e.g., "BTC December 2025 Futures"). When the date gets here, the agreement resolves, and all positions are shut.
2. Continuous Futures Agreements (The copyright Criterion).
These are one of the most popular and special function of copyright trading. Perpetual futures are agreements that never run out. To keep the futures rate tethered to the existing market value of the hidden asset (the area rate), they make use of a mechanism called the Financing Price. Investors that get on the side of the trade that is leading in the market (e.g., long if there are a lot more longs than shorts) pay a tiny cost to the other side every couple of hours.
Secret Terminology.
Underlying Possession: The actual copyright being traded (e.g., BTC, ETH).
Leverage: The capability to regulate a large contract value with a percentage of resources (margin). As an example, 10x take advantage of means a $1,000 margin can manage a $10,000 setting. This magnifies both revenues and losses.
Margin: The first collateral you need to upload to open and maintain a futures setting.
Liquidation: The forced closure of a trader's setting by the exchange when the margin drops below the minimum required upkeep degree, usually because the market has actually moved versus the trade. This is the largest danger for novices copyright trading.
How copyright Futures Trading Functions.
The main allure of futures trading is the capability to benefit whether the market increases or down, and the capability to make use of leverage.
Going Long vs. Going Short.
Going Long ( Favorable Wager): You buy a futures agreement thinking the rate of the underlying copyright will certainly climb. You benefit if the cost rises.
Going Short (Bearish Wager): You market a futures contract believing the price of the underlying copyright will drop. You benefit if the rate reduces.
The Power and Risk of Leverage.
Leverage is the double-edged sword of futures trading. It permits a tiny market motion to create huge returns, yet an equally tiny relocate the incorrect direction can eliminate your margin rapidly.
Example:.
You have $100.
You utilize 10x take advantage of to open up a BTC Long placement worth $1,000.
If BTC increases 10%, your $1,000 placement is currently worth $1,100, giving you a 100% return on your first $100 margin.
If BTC goes down 10%, your $1,000 setting is currently worth $900. Your $100 margin is eliminated, and your placement is liquidated.
Understanding this liquidation point is vital for anybody discovering how to trade copyright 2025.
Vital Actions: Just How to Profession copyright 2025 Futures.
For the newbie, a organized technique is essential to navigate the high-risk environment.
Action 1: Select a Reliable Exchange and Configuration.
Select a significant copyright by-products exchange that uses durable protection and high liquidity. You'll need to total KYC (Know Your Consumer) and deposit the copyright you intend to utilize as margin ( typically BTC, ETH, or a stablecoin like USDT).
Action 2: Master Threat Monitoring FIRST.
Prior to positioning your first profession, develop a rigorous danger administration method:.
Placement Sizing: Never run the risk of more than 1-2% of your complete trading funding on a solitary profession.
Take advantage of: Beginning with low leverage, like 3x or 5x. Do not use 100x utilize-- this is a gaming technique, not a profitable strategy.
Stop-Loss: Identify your exit point prior to entering the profession. A stop-loss order is non-negotiable and the main device against liquidation.
Step 3: Understand Order Types.
Futures trading involves more complicated order kinds than straightforward place acquiring:.
Market Order: Executes quickly at the existing best available price. Use sparingly because of slippage.
Limit Order: Sets a details rate for your buy or sell. This is the favored technique for self-displined trading.
Stop-Loss Order: An order that comes to be a market or restriction order when a certain rate is struck, utilized to cut losses.
Take-Profit Order: An order that sells your position when a earnings target is reached.
Step 4: Analyze and Perform Your Trade.
Use technical analysis (charts, signs) or basic evaluation (news, tokenomics) to form a trade idea. Execute the trade, making sure to all at once establish your Stop-Loss and Take-Profit orders. This is the core of your day-to-day copyright trading practices.
Tip 5: Display and Manage Your Margin.
Keep a close eye on your Margin Ratio. If the market relocates versus you, you might be required to post even more margin (a margin call) to prevent liquidation. Do not wait on a margin phone call; if the trade hits your pre-set stop-loss, shut it quickly and approve the small loss.
The Biggest Dangers in copyright Futures.
Recognizing the risks is the very first step to alleviating them, specifically when learning how to trade copyright 2025.
1. Liquidation Danger.
As pointed out, utilize can bring about losing your whole margin promptly. A little percentage swing can result in a 100% loss of your profession funding. This is the key reason newbies stop working.
2. High Costs.
Along with standard trading fees, you need to think about the Financing Price (for continuous contracts). If you are continually on the side that pays the financing price, these tiny fees can compound over time and Beginners copyright trading substantially lower your lasting success.
3. Market Volatility.
copyright markets are infamously unstable. Unexpected, deep price spikes (wicks) can cause stop-loss orders or, worse, liquidate placements prior to the price recuperates.
4. Slippage.
Throughout high volatility, the price you execute your market order at can be different (and even worse) than the price you saw. This is called slippage, and it can adversely influence your access or leave.
